When your Milwaukee M18 battery shows 1 LED flash, it indicates the battery charge is critically low (under 20%) and needs immediate recharging. This is a normal protective feature that prevents complete battery discharge and potential damage.

When to Call a Professional

Contact Milwaukee customer service if the battery won't charge after following these steps, if it gets extremely hot during charging, or if it consistently loses charge quickly after a full charge cycle. These symptoms may indicate internal battery cell damage requiring professional replacement.

Frequently Asked Questions

Why does my Milwaukee M18 battery only flash 1 LED?
A single LED flash on your Milwaukee M18 battery indicates the charge level is below 20%. This is a normal low battery warning that tells you to recharge the battery immediately before continued use.
How long does it take to charge a Milwaukee M18 battery from 1 LED?
Charging time depends on the battery capacity. Standard 1.5Ah-2.0Ah batteries take 30-60 minutes, while high-capacity 5.0Ah-12.0Ah batteries can take 60-120 minutes to fully charge from a low state.
Can I continue using my Milwaukee tool with 1 LED flashing?
While the tool may still operate briefly with 1 LED flashing, it's recommended to stop use and charge immediately. Continuing to use a critically low battery can cause sudden shutdowns and may damage the battery cells.
What if my M18 battery still shows 1 LED after charging overnight?
If the battery still shows only 1 LED after a complete charging cycle, the battery cells may be damaged or have reached end of life. Try the charger with a different battery to rule out charger issues, then consider battery replacement.
Is it normal for Milwaukee M18 batteries to get warm while charging?
Slight warmth during charging is normal, but the battery should not get hot. If the battery becomes too hot to touch, stop charging immediately and allow it to cool. Excessive heat may indicate a faulty battery or charger.
